On Tuesday, Governor Kathy Hochul delivered her State of the State Address, and in it was a call to help expand funding for NYC’s P-Tech program (Pathways to Technology Early College High School), of which CSI is a partner with Port Richmond High School. As reported on in the Staten Island Advance, Gov. Hochul is investing an additional $20M in support of the program. Staten Island established its program in 2020, where enrolled Port Richmond students undergo a six-year curriculum that allows them to receive a high school diploma and a tuition-free associate degree from CSI.
